Commit BBC
This commit is contained in:
@@ -882,15 +882,10 @@ ss CleaningSequence{
|
|||||||
ss ShotSequence {
|
ss ShotSequence {
|
||||||
state NonShoting {
|
state NonShoting {
|
||||||
entry {
|
entry {
|
||||||
strcpy(msg, "Waiting for Trigger...");
|
|
||||||
pvPut(msg);
|
|
||||||
errlogSevPrintf(NO_ALARM, "%s\n",msg);
|
|
||||||
IsttokWSHOTINGSTATE = WSHTST_NonShoting;
|
IsttokWSHOTINGSTATE = WSHTST_NonShoting;
|
||||||
pvPut(IsttokWSHOTINGSTATE);
|
pvPut(IsttokWSHOTINGSTATE);
|
||||||
strcpy(IsttokShotCountdownScan, "Passive");
|
strcpy(IsttokShotCountdownScan, "Passive");
|
||||||
pvPut(IsttokShotCountdownScan);
|
pvPut(IsttokShotCountdownScan);
|
||||||
// IsttokShotCountdown = 160;
|
|
||||||
// pvPut(IsttokShotCountdown);
|
|
||||||
}
|
}
|
||||||
when( IsttokOPSTATE == POS_WaitShot ){
|
when( IsttokOPSTATE == POS_WaitShot ){
|
||||||
strcpy(msg, "Waiting for Trigger...");
|
strcpy(msg, "Waiting for Trigger...");
|
||||||
@@ -911,6 +906,8 @@ ss ShotSequence {
|
|||||||
errlogSevPrintf(NO_ALARM, "%s\n",msg);
|
errlogSevPrintf(NO_ALARM, "%s\n",msg);
|
||||||
strcpy(IsttokShotCountdownScan, "Passive");
|
strcpy(IsttokShotCountdownScan, "Passive");
|
||||||
pvPut(IsttokShotCountdownScan);
|
pvPut(IsttokShotCountdownScan);
|
||||||
|
IsttokProcReq = STOP;
|
||||||
|
pvPut(IsttokProcReq);
|
||||||
IsttokWSHOTINGSTATE = WSHTST_NonShoting;
|
IsttokWSHOTINGSTATE = WSHTST_NonShoting;
|
||||||
pvPut(IsttokWSHOTINGSTATE);
|
pvPut(IsttokWSHOTINGSTATE);
|
||||||
IsttokOPSTATE = POS_Process;
|
IsttokOPSTATE = POS_Process;
|
||||||
@@ -921,8 +918,6 @@ ss ShotSequence {
|
|||||||
pvPut(msg);
|
pvPut(msg);
|
||||||
IsttokShotCountdown = -70;
|
IsttokShotCountdown = -70;
|
||||||
pvPut(IsttokShotCountdown);
|
pvPut(IsttokShotCountdown);
|
||||||
// strcpy(IsttokShotCountdownScan, "1 second");
|
|
||||||
// pvPut(IsttokShotCountdownScan);
|
|
||||||
IsttokWSHOTINGSTATE = WSHTST_Shoting2;
|
IsttokWSHOTINGSTATE = WSHTST_Shoting2;
|
||||||
pvPut(IsttokWSHOTINGSTATE);
|
pvPut(IsttokWSHOTINGSTATE);
|
||||||
} state Shoting2
|
} state Shoting2
|
||||||
|
|||||||
@@ -1,19 +1,14 @@
|
|||||||
ISTTOK:central:PULSE-NUMBER.VAL
|
ISTTOK:central:PULSE-NUMBER.VAL
|
||||||
ISTTOK:central:PROCESS-MODE.VAL
|
|
||||||
|
|
||||||
ISTTOK:central:TMPump1-ManualValve.VAL
|
|
||||||
|
|
||||||
ISTTOK:central:LASTOPSTATE.VAL
|
ISTTOK:central:LASTOPSTATE.VAL
|
||||||
ISTTOK:central:OPREQ
|
ISTTOK:central:OPREQ
|
||||||
ISTTOK:central:PROCESS-MODE.VAL
|
ISTTOK:central:PROCESS-MODE.VAL
|
||||||
#ISTTOK:central:PROCESS-REQ.VAL
|
|
||||||
#ISTTOK:central:STARTINGSTATE.VAL
|
|
||||||
#ISTTOK:central:STOPPINGSTATE.VAL
|
|
||||||
#ISTTOK:central:CLEANINGSTATE.VAL
|
|
||||||
ISTTOK:central:CLEANINGMANMODE.VAL
|
ISTTOK:central:CLEANINGMANMODE.VAL
|
||||||
#ISTTOK:central:WSHOTINGSTATE.VAL
|
|
||||||
|
|
||||||
ISTTOK:central:Emergency-UserButton.VAL
|
ISTTOK:central:Emergency-UserButton.VAL
|
||||||
|
ISTTOK:central:TMPump1-ManualValve.VAL
|
||||||
|
|
||||||
|
#ALARM Limits
|
||||||
ISTTOK:central:RPump1-Pressure.HIGH
|
ISTTOK:central:RPump1-Pressure.HIGH
|
||||||
ISTTOK:central:RPump1-Pressure.HIHI
|
ISTTOK:central:RPump1-Pressure.HIHI
|
||||||
ISTTOK:central:RPump2-Pressure.HIGH
|
ISTTOK:central:RPump2-Pressure.HIGH
|
||||||
|
|||||||
@@ -1,12 +1,11 @@
|
|||||||
# autosave R5.3 Automatically generated - DO NOT MODIFY - 191205-170936
|
# autosave R5.3 Automatically generated - DO NOT MODIFY - 191205-191128
|
||||||
ISTTOK:central:PULSE-NUMBER.VAL 0
|
ISTTOK:central:PULSE-NUMBER.VAL 46294
|
||||||
ISTTOK:central:PROCESS-MODE.VAL 1
|
|
||||||
ISTTOK:central:TMPump1-ManualValve.VAL 1
|
|
||||||
ISTTOK:central:LASTOPSTATE.VAL 2
|
ISTTOK:central:LASTOPSTATE.VAL 2
|
||||||
ISTTOK:central:OPREQ 1
|
ISTTOK:central:OPREQ 1
|
||||||
ISTTOK:central:PROCESS-MODE.VAL 1
|
ISTTOK:central:PROCESS-MODE.VAL 1
|
||||||
ISTTOK:central:CLEANINGMANMODE.VAL 1
|
ISTTOK:central:CLEANINGMANMODE.VAL 1
|
||||||
ISTTOK:central:Emergency-UserButton.VAL 0
|
ISTTOK:central:Emergency-UserButton.VAL 0
|
||||||
|
ISTTOK:central:TMPump1-ManualValve.VAL 1
|
||||||
ISTTOK:central:RPump1-Pressure.HIGH 0.05
|
ISTTOK:central:RPump1-Pressure.HIGH 0.05
|
||||||
ISTTOK:central:RPump1-Pressure.HIHI 0.1
|
ISTTOK:central:RPump1-Pressure.HIHI 0.1
|
||||||
ISTTOK:central:RPump2-Pressure.HIGH 0.05
|
ISTTOK:central:RPump2-Pressure.HIGH 0.05
|
||||||
|
|||||||
@@ -67,4 +67,3 @@ create_monitor_set("$(IOC).req", 30)
|
|||||||
|
|
||||||
## Start any sequence programs
|
## Start any sequence programs
|
||||||
seq IsttokSeqExec
|
seq IsttokSeqExec
|
||||||
#, "unit=ISTTOK"
|
|
||||||
|
|||||||
Reference in New Issue
Block a user